AI in Life Sciences Needs Review Workflows, Not Just Better Prompts

Life sciences teams can use AI for drafting and analysis while preserving scientific, medical, legal, and regulatory review.

Life sciences teams are adopting AI for literature monitoring, medical writing support, competitive intelligence, pharmacovigilance triage, and commercial content operations. The immediate productivity gains are real, but prompts alone are not enough to make these systems durable.

The core implementation challenge is workflow design. AI output has to move through the same quality expectations as other scientific and regulated work.

Drafting Is Not Approval

Generative systems can help produce first drafts, summaries, variants, and structured notes. That does not mean the output is approved evidence. Teams should separate draft generation from scientific validation and final approval.

This distinction sounds basic, but it prevents a common failure mode: treating a fast draft as a finished asset because it looks complete.

Reviewers Need Evidence, Not Just Text

Medical, legal, and regulatory reviewers need to see the source trail. A useful AI workflow should preserve citations, source snippets, dates, model prompts, and version history. Reviewers should not have to reverse-engineer where a claim came from.

The review package should answer three questions: what was generated, what sources informed it, and what changed after human review.

Claims Management Should Be Built In

For commercial and medical affairs content, claims are the risk surface. AI tools should be constrained by approved claims libraries, product labels, publication libraries, and local market rules.

If a system can generate unsupported claims freely, teams will spend the productivity gain on rework and risk review. A better pattern is to make approved claims easier to use than unsupported ones.

Audit Trails Should Be Automatic

Manual tracking breaks down as usage grows. The workflow should automatically record topic, prompt version, model version, source set, draft owner, reviewer, approval status, and publication destination.

This audit trail is useful for compliance, but it is also useful for improvement. Teams can see which prompts produce rework, which topics require escalation, and which content formats perform best.

Start With Low-Regret Use Cases

The best early use cases usually support internal productivity without replacing professional judgment. Examples include literature watchlists, internal briefings, structured meeting notes, and first-pass content outlines.

These workflows build capability while keeping the blast radius small. They also create the governance muscles needed for more complex systems later.

The Durable Advantage Is Operating Discipline

Better models will keep arriving. The organizations that benefit most will be the ones with clear review gates, source governance, claims controls, and monitoring. In life sciences, AI maturity is less about prompt tricks and more about controlled workflows that make quality easier to sustain.
